计算机科学

首页 > 计算机科学

屏幕保护程序

Netshade-256.png

屏幕保护程序是计算机程序,原意是通过将画面空白,或在画面上填满移动的视频,避免计算机CRT显示器在静止的情况下产生磷质烙印,从而减低其寿命。现在,屏幕保护程序被用作娱乐或保安用途。

目录

  • 1 用途
  • 2 缺点
  • 3 Windows 的屏幕保护程序
  • 4 参考资料

用途

在液晶显示器发明之前,大多数的计算机显示屏都是使用阴极射线管(显像管)所制成的。当显像管显示屏显示一个静止的图像很长一段时间后,显示屏内部的磷光薄膜就会逐渐且永久地改变它的性质,最终在显示屏上留下无法抹去的残影,这就是所谓的磷质烙印。电视、示波器或是任何使用显像管的设备都会受到磷质烙印的损害。等离子显示器或多或少也会产生相同的情况。

屏幕保护程序可以避免上述的情况发生。它可以在画面静止时自动改变显示屏图像。

公共设施上的显像管显示屏,像是自动提款机和自动售票机,受到磷质烙印损害的机率更大,因为它们长时间显示待机画面。一些没有考虑到磷质烙印的老旧机器常常有着明显的显示屏损伤痕迹。比如,当用户已经开始操作自动提款机时显示屏上还留有“请插入卡片”的残影。关闭显示屏不会是个好办法,因为这会让用户以为机器故障。为了避免发生这种情况,过个几秒显示屏就会自动变换显示图像、播映视频或是改变图像在显示屏上的位置。

现在的显像管显示屏比起以前较不受到磷质烙印的影响,这要归功于对磷光薄膜的改良和如今计算机图像的低对比度,而早期的图像大多为黑白的。液晶显示器不会有磷质烙印的问题因为视频不是直接靠磷光体产生的(但有可能产生暂时的烙印现象)。因此,如今的屏幕保护程序大多作为装饰用。

缺点

现在计算机大部分都使用液晶显示器作为显示屏输出。屏幕保护程序会令其寿命时间减少,这是因为显示屏背光会在屏幕保护程序运行时持续地通电,加速背光设备老化,最后要将整个显示屏更换。

另外,屏幕保护程序可能会占用中央处理器大量的计算性能,加上显示屏在屏幕保护程序运作时同样耗用电力,因此在屏幕保护程序运行时会大幅增加计算机的耗电量。

所以,以现代科技而言“屏幕保护程序”是名不副实的。

Windows 的屏幕保护程序

Windows 的屏幕保护程序以 SCR 为扩展名,实质上是一个导出了 ScreenSaverProc 和 ScreenSaverConfigureDialog 两个函数的 PE 文件。Windows 会自动扫描 Windows 安装目录和系统目录下的 *.SCR 文件列在屏幕保护列表中。[1]

参考资料

  1. ^ Handling Screen Savers. Microsoft. 2017-01-08 [2017-01-08]. 

下一篇:虚拟主机
相关推荐